数据库连接不上什么服务器

fiy 其他 3

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    当数据库连接不上服务器时,可能有以下几个原因:

    1. 网络连接问题:首先,需要检查网络连接是否正常。可以通过尝试访问其他网站或使用ping命令来测试网络连接。如果网络连接存在问题,可能是由于网络故障、防火墙设置或者网络配置错误导致的。

    2. 服务器状态问题:其次,需要确保数据库服务器正常运行。可以检查服务器是否已经启动,并且数据库服务是否正在运行。如果数据库服务没有启动或者崩溃,可能需要重新启动服务或者修复数据库。

    3. 数据库配置问题:还有可能是数据库连接配置出现了问题。需要检查连接字符串的配置是否正确,包括数据库的主机名、端口号、用户名、密码等信息。有时候,可能是由于配置错误导致无法连接。

    4. 数据库访问权限问题:最后,还需要检查数据库用户是否具有足够的权限来访问数据库。如果数据库用户没有正确的权限,将无法连接数据库。

    如果以上步骤都没有解决问题,可以尝试以下措施:

    1. 检查防火墙设置:确保防火墙没有阻止数据库连接。可以尝试暂时关闭防火墙或者配置防火墙规则来允许数据库连接。

    2. 检查数据库日志:查看数据库的错误日志,可能会提供更多的信息来解决连接问题。

    3. 重启服务器:有时候,重启服务器可以解决一些临时的连接问题。

    总结起来,当数据库连接不上服务器时,需要依次检查网络连接、服务器状态、数据库配置和数据库访问权限等方面的问题。根据具体情况进行排查和解决。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论
    1. 检查数据库服务器是否正常运行:首先,确保数据库服务器已经启动并正在运行。可以尝试使用命令行工具或管理工具连接到数据库服务器,确保它可以正常连接。

    2. 检查网络连接是否正常:确保你的计算机和数据库服务器之间的网络连接正常。可以尝试使用 ping 命令来测试与数据库服务器的网络连接是否正常。

    3. 检查连接字符串是否正确:连接数据库时,需要提供正确的连接字符串。确保连接字符串中包含正确的数据库服务器地址、端口号、用户名和密码。

    4. 检查防火墙设置:防火墙可能会阻止你的计算机连接到数据库服务器。确保防火墙设置允许你的计算机与数据库服务器之间的通信。

    5. 检查数据库权限:如果你使用的是有权限限制的数据库,确保你有足够的权限连接到数据库服务器。如果没有足够的权限,无法连接到数据库服务器。

    如果按照以上步骤检查后仍然无法连接到数据库服务器,可能需要进一步调查和排除其他可能的问题,例如数据库服务器配置错误、网络故障等。在这种情况下,建议寻求专业人士的帮助,例如数据库管理员或网络管理员。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    当数据库连接不上服务器时,可能存在以下几种情况和解决方案:

    1. 网络连接问题:

      • 检查网络连接是否正常,确保服务器和数据库所在的网络环境正常运行。
      • 检查服务器和数据库所在的网络配置,确保网络设置正确。
    2. 服务器配置问题:

      • 检查服务器上的数据库服务是否正常运行,确保数据库服务已启动。
      • 检查服务器的防火墙配置,确保数据库端口未被阻止。
      • 检查服务器上的数据库配置文件,确保数据库连接设置正确。
    3. 数据库配置问题:

      • 检查数据库的连接参数,确保主机名、端口号、用户名和密码等设置正确。
      • 检查数据库的访问权限,确保数据库用户具有连接数据库的权限。
      • 检查数据库的连接数限制,确保数据库连接数未达到上限。
    4. 客户端配置问题:

      • 检查客户端的数据库驱动是否正确安装,并且与数据库版本兼容。
      • 检查客户端的数据库连接参数,确保与服务器上的数据库配置一致。
      • 检查客户端的防火墙配置,确保数据库连接端口未被阻止。
    5. 数据库故障:

      • 检查数据库的日志文件,查看是否存在异常错误信息。
      • 检查数据库的存储空间,确保数据库有足够的空间进行连接和操作。
      • 检查数据库的运行状态,确保数据库正常运行。
    6. 其他问题:

      • 检查数据库连接的代码逻辑,确保没有编程错误导致连接失败。
      • 尝试重新启动服务器和数据库,以解决可能的临时问题。
      • 如果以上方法都无法解决问题,可以尝试联系数据库管理员或技术支持人员,寻求进一步的帮助。

    在处理数据库连接问题时,需要仔细检查和分析可能的原因,并根据具体情况采取相应的解决方案。同时,及时备份重要的数据,以防数据丢失或损坏。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部